EBSA's Cybersecurity Guidance for Retirement Plans

Highlights
The EBSA’s cybersecurity guidance provides a road map for ERISA plan fiduciaries to hedge against cybersecurity risks to retirement plans
Service provider contracts should be reviewed to incorporate cybersecurity provisions aligned with EBSA’s guidance
Plan fiduciaries should communicate EBSA’s guidance to participants so they can take steps to protect their retirement account security
On April 14, 2021, the U.S. Department of Labor’s Employee Benefits Security Administration (EBSA) issued guidance on cybersecurity for ERISA pension benefit plans, in response to the Government Accountability Office’s request for suggestions on how benefit plan officials should hedge against cybersecurity risks threatening plan assets and plan participant data.
